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Radcliffe (Nottinghamshire) to Southease start from as little as £25.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Radcliffe (Nottinghamshire) to Southease start from £117.60 one way, or £122.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Radcliffe (Nottinghamshire) to Southease are available for £173.10 one way, or £339.10 return

Station Facilities and User Experience

Radcliffe station embraces simplicity. Ticket purchasing facilities are minimal, with no ticket office or collection machines available. While the absence of these might sound inconvenient, it adds to the station's unique charm of encouraging passengers to plan ahead and purchase tickets online or via mobile apps.

This station is equipped with vital information facilities, including help points with induction loops to assist passengers, particularly those who are hearing-impaired. However, there are no customer services staff or waiting rooms, offering a serene throughway rather than a bustling hub. Accessibility is a conscious effort at Radcliffe, with step-free access available to Platform 1. For those needing assistance, advanced booking through Passenger Assist is suggested to ensure a smooth journey.

Facilities and Amenities at Southease Station

Southease station emphasizes functionality over opulence. While you won't find a bustling ticket office here, the station offers ticket machines to facilitate the collection of online-purchased tickets. These machines cater to passengers with disabilities, offering the convenience of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Though the station doesn't have ticket barriers, travelers can utilize smartcard validators for ease of travel.

For assistance, the station is equipped with help points and departure screens to make your journey as smooth as possible. Be mindful that while on-duty help is limited, the presence of CCTV ensures a level of safety. It's worth noting that there are no waiting rooms, accessible toilets, or refreshment facilities available at Southease, so planning ahead is advised.

Accessibility and Travel Connections

Southease station has made strides toward accessibility with step-free access available through short, steep ramps. While staff assistance is not typically available, help can be arranged in advance via Southern Railway's Assisted Travel service.
